KUCHING, Feb 14: With growing demand for a stable and reliable electricity supply, Sarawak Energy has commissioned Malaysia's first utility-scale Battery Energy Storage System (BESS) at Sejingkat Power Plant—a RM128 million facility with a 60-megawatt (MW) capacity and. . Sarawak Energy, commissioner of the 60 MW/82 MWh battery energy storage system (BESS), is one of the biggest utilities serving Sarawak, a Malaysian territory on Borneo island. The project, which is Malaysia's first large-scale electrochemical energy storage system, was undertaken by China Energy Engineering Group Jiangsu Institute under an EPC (Engineering, Procurement, and Construction) contract.

A battery energy storage system (BESS), battery storage power station, battery energy grid storage (BEGS) or battery grid storage is a type of energy storage technology that uses a group of batteries in the grid to store electrical energy. Definition: Power capacity refers to the maximum rate at which an energy storage system can deliver or absorb energy at a given moment. Units: Measured in kilowatts (kW) or megawatts (MW). . Electrical Energy Storage (EES) systems store electricity and convert it back to electrical energy when needed. Lithium-ion battery pack prices have fallen nearly 84% from more than $780/kWh in 2013 to $139/kWh in 2024, according to Bloomberg New Energy Finance.

Grid-scale storage refers to technologies connected to the power grid that can store energy and then supply it back to the grid at a more advantageous time – for example, at night, when no solar power is available, or during a weather event that disrupts electricity generation. Battery energy storage systems are generally designed to deliver their full rated power for durations ranging from 1 to 4 hours, with emerging technologies extending this to longer durations to meet evolving grid demands.
